About Community Powered Federal Credit Union of Bear

Community Powered Federal Credit Union is a credit union in Bear, Delaware, serving individuals and businesses across New Castle County, north of the Chesapeake and Delaware Canal. Founded in 1962 as DPL Federal Credit Union, the institution was established to support employees of the Delmarva Power & Light Company, guided by a mission to prioritize member financial welfare. Over time, it expanded its field of membership to include employees of the News Journal Company, Hercules, Incorporated, and eventually the broader community of Wilmington. The credit union offers a full range of services, including checking and savings accounts, personal and auto loans, mortgage lending, debit and credit cards, and digital banking tools. It maintains a strong commitment to responsible lending and member service, with a network of branches across the region, including its headquarters in Bear. Rooted in a legacy of vision and community focus, the credit union traces its origins to Joseph Leary, its first president, who emphasized forward-thinking financial stewardship. The organization evolved through strategic expansions, including the 2004 inclusion of employees from the News Journal Company and Hercules, and the 2005 acquisition of United Communities Credit Union. In 2009, it received a federal charter under the name Community Powered Credit Union, reflecting its broader mission. The credit union continues to operate with a focus on member empowerment, maintaining consistent lending standards and expanding access through strategic branch relocations, such as the move of the News Journal branch to Quigley Boulevard and Route 273 for greater accessibility.

The credit union’s headquarters is located at 1758 Pulaski Highway in Bear, Delaware. This location serves as the central hub for its operations, including its primary branch and administrative functions. The building is situated along a major regional roadway, providing easy access for members throughout New Castle County.
